Output 8c8585ffd7bc8dc44d5114c70b95753f8e4231e6efbe9b8834e904afe5f9cd47:0

value
22493
script pubkey
OP_0 OP_PUSHBYTES_20 b23dc64b87fa30b6cc78898064f32ebf65018d1d
address
bc1qkg7uvju8lgctdnrc3xqxfuewhajsrrga0ymwul
transaction
8c8585ffd7bc8dc44d5114c70b95753f8e4231e6efbe9b8834e904afe5f9cd47
confirmations
61507
spent
true